I'm a broke student who is set to receive €400 (about $465) from my parents in November and I'm looking to upgrade from my RTX 3070 during Black Friday. I was initially considering the RX 9060 XT at €379 ($440) without any discounts, but I'm wondering if I should stretch my budget to buy the RX 9070 XT for €650 ($755), along with a new PSU (around $110) since my current MSI 650W won't cut it. I can't wait until next month because GPUs tend to be rare after Black Friday and are quite pricey in my country. So, I'm asking, is it really worth going broke for the RX 9070 XT?
